Popularity of ME at University of Arizona

During the 2020-2021 academic year, University of Arizona handed out 117 bachelor's degrees in mechanical engineering. This is a decrease of 9% over the previous year when 128 degrees were handed out.

In 2021, 16 students received their master’s degree in me from University of Arizona. This makes it the #115 most popular school for me master’s degree candidates in the country.

In addition, 4 students received their doctoral degrees in me in 2021, making the school the #105 most popular school in the United States for this category of students.

How Much Do ME Graduates from University of Arizona Make?

$65,774 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of ME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

The median salary of me students who receive their bachelor's degree at University of Arizona is $65,774. This is higher than $65,190, which is the national median for all me bachelor's degree recipients.

How Much Student Debt Do ME Graduates from University of Arizona Have?

$23,391 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of ME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

While getting their bachelor's degree at University of Arizona, me students borrow a median amount of $23,391 in student loans. This is not too bad considering that the median debt load of all me bachelor's degree recipients across the country is $25,000.

The typical student loan payment of a bachelor's degree student from the me program at University of Arizona is $278 per month.

University of Arizona Mechanical Engineering Bachelor’s Program

In the 2020-2021 academic year, 117 students earned a bachelor's degree in me from University of Arizona. About 18% of these graduates were women and the other 82% were men.
